CBNSat TV network launched



Sri Arthur C. Clarke inaugurating the network. CEO M. Canagey looks on.
Picture by Sumanachandra Ariyawansa

Sri Lanka's first Satellite digital Video Broadcast (DVB-S) Direct to Home (DTH) network was launched by the Communiq Broadband Network (Private) Ltd. (CBNSat) last Friday.

This service is now accessible to all Sri Lankans throughout the island and has capability and infrastructure to broadcast up to 120 channels which include a wide area of news, education, sports action and movies.

CEO of CBNSat, Muhunthan Canagey said that this satellite television network would provide Sri Lankans throughout the island with a unique television experience irrespective of geographical parameters, at a very affordable rate of Rs 500 per month.

The company has tied up with 24 channel partners including CNN, BBC, Pogo, Cartoon Network, MTV, VH1, Nickolodian, Raj, Raj Digital, Animal Planet, The History Channel, National Geographic channel , etc to provide a premium quality service to Sri Lankans.

The high level of audio-visual quality, and the islandwide coverage are the advantages that the viewers of CBNSat could experience. The company has ensured the availability of the complete set of equipment required to connect to the satellite television network partnering with Singer Sri Lanka.

The Distance Learning Facility is another advantage provided through CBNSat which would enable Sri Lankan students to access and view course support programmes on TV just as they would watch a normal television programme upon signing up with the relevant distant learning centre.

The company has been able to provide employment to a large number of youth at its office in Kotahena.
